Rewrite My Youth Chapter 1241

On an afternoon with no classes, Wen Ying visited the film set again. The crew was busy at work. Wen Ying and Shui Mingyue sat under the sunshade. Shui Mingyue quietly told Wen Ying about what had happened in the past few days.

Wen Ying was in a great mood. Her tone revealed happiness. “You made things clear with him. Has he not been pestering you?”

Shui Mingyue shook her head. “The set is full of people coming and going. I do not want to be alone with him again. He has no opportunity.”

Luo Hao had no chance to pester Shui Mingyue in conversation, yet he often looked at her with that wounded expression.

Shui Mingyue had worried that unfavourable gossip might spread on the set, such as rumours of her leading him on and then abandoning him. Unexpectedly, no one cared at all.

Perhaps everyone on the crew was simply too busy.

Anyway, forget it. Since no one was gossiping, Shui Mingyue felt much more relaxed.

When Wen Ying heard Shui Mingyue say that now the female lead clung to her every day, calling her “Teacher Mingyue” sweetly and constantly gazing at her with admiring eyes, she could not help chuckling. “Have you noticed that the female lead understands your works very well too?”

Shui Mingyue felt embarrassed. “How did you know?”

Wen Ying laughed heartily. “What is strange about that? They are playing the male and female leads from your novel. How could they act without understanding your works? If it were me, I would not only read your book ten or eight times. I would also search online for all sorts of reviews to see how other readers and industry professionals interpret it! Mingyue, this is not some fateful connection. It is the basic professionalism needed to succeed in the entertainment industry, just like how we research a lot of material before starting to write.”

Shui Mingyue fell silent for a moment, then adopted a posture of lying flat and accepting mockery. “I understand. You mean Luo Hao was deliberately catering to me from the start… Alright, thinking back now, it does seem that way. Go ahead and laugh. I will not interrupt you.”

Shui Mingyue allowed Wen Ying to laugh freely, but Wen Ying stopped laughing instead.

“I was wrong. Regardless of how Luo Hao treated you, your fondness for him was certainly genuine.”

Shui Mingyue nodded lightly. “Yes, it was.”

Shui Mingyue also realised she might have liked the wrong person, but she would not deny what had happened. Her fondness for Luo Hao was completely sincere, without any falsehood.

Wen Ying was whispering with Shui Mingyue when the female lead finished her scene. Accompanied by her assistant, she walked towards the sunshade.

“Am I interrupting the two teachers?”

Wen Ying noticed that the female lead was always smiling brightly.

What is wrong with a girl who loves to smile having a bit of ambition? Girls do not deceive other girls’ feelings. Or rather, she had clear goals and never hid her ambition. This made it hard for Wen Ying to dislike her. It was like Yao Xiaojia working as a real estate agent. Clients knew her enthusiastic attitude was to close deals, yet she would not cheat them for a sale. Instead, she used her knowledge of properties to analyse seriously for clients, considering their needs and helping them choose the most suitable home. How could clients dislike such enthusiasm?

In Wen Ying’s eyes, the female lead was just like that.

Compared to Luo Hao’s evasiveness, the female lead never concealed her ambition.

When ambition does not harm others, it should not be disliked.

“Sit down. You are not interrupting us. Mingyue and I were just talking about you.”

The female lead’s eyes lit up. “Really? Teacher Xiaoyu, what did you say about me? Ah, I know. Teacher Mingyue must have said my comprehension is too poor!”

Wen Ying smiled and praised her. “Mingyue said you have strong comprehension, act seriously, and work hard. When this drama airs, you will definitely become popular!”

The female lead was delighted. “Then I will borrow your auspicious words!”

Shui Mingyue gave Wen Ying a reproachful glance. She had indeed said the female lead acted seriously. But whether she would become popular after airing, how could Shui Mingyue guarantee that!

Shui Mingyue thought Wen Ying was just being polite, unaware that Wen Ying was telling the plain truth.

For idol dramas adapted from romance novels, the male lead must be handsome. The female lead does not need to be stunningly beautiful. In fact, brightly glamorous looks in idol dramas usually play the second female lead. Those who play the main female lead are generally fresh and cute, the enduringly attractive girl-next-door type.

Romance writers do this to help readers better identify with the female lead. The same applies when adapted into dramas. Casting a brightly glamorous actress as the female lead creates distance for viewers.

The female lead in Shui Mingyue’s drama had a very fresh appearance.

Not exceptionally beautiful, but she grew on you upon closer look. Not a vivid flower on the branch, but more like a gentle breeze passing through the blossoms. Viewers seeing her on screen would feel a refreshing comfort, like a cool breeze on the face. This breeze was not aggressive. Savouring it carefully revealed a faint floral fragrance.

In her previous life, Shui Mingyue’s drama was delayed until 2012 to air. Those years saw a boom in youth campus films. After airing, the female lead gained much attention for her fresh looks and natural performance.

Viewers thought a new star was rising. People said Shui Mingyue’s drama made both leads famous. Luo Hao indeed became hugely popular. Yet the female lead seemed to vanish from the entertainment industry. Digging deeper, this was an old drama from five years prior. In the five years from filming to airing, the female lead had actually retired and married!

Yes, this ambitious female lead standing before Wen Ying retired and married not long after finishing Shui Mingyue’s drama, never waiting for the day of great fame… Earlier, Wen Ying’s attention had been on Shui Mingyue retiring from writing, leaving no room to focus on others. Now thinking about it, this drama was truly cursed. Shui Mingyue retired, the female lead quit the industry, and only the male lead, after five years of obscurity, became massively famous!

Wen Ying’s usual thinking was that whoever ultimately benefited might be the most suspicious.

Thinking this way, the one who ultimately profited seemed to be only Luo Hao.

Unsure if Luo Hao had completely given up or would continue entangling Shui Mingyue, following the principle of better safe than sorry, Wen Ying prepared to further consolidate the results.

Wen Ying chatted idly with the female lead for a bit. Once the female lead relaxed, she casually asked as if joking, “A writer friend of mine is recently plotting a new book with a very abusive segment. It is roughly about a girl who desperately wants to be a star. The girl truly has talent in acting and a good image. She is determined to succeed. After entering the industry, she faces all sorts of difficulties. But the girl is clever. Even if overcoming obstacles is not elegant or graceful, she still passes each hurdle and finally gets the chance to play the female lead.”

Both Shui Mingyue and the female lead listened attentively.

Shui Mingyue wondered who this “writer friend” Wen Ying mentioned was. Her first thought was that Wen Ying was making it up, the so-called friend being Wen Ying herself.

She quickly dismissed this guess. Wen Ying’s focus in the coming years was clearly the Jiuding series. She had heard Wen Ying was writing the second book recently. Where would she find time for another new book?

Moreover, Wen Ying had already written “Starry River and You”. She probably would not write the same type again.

So there really was a “writer friend” discussing plots with Wen Ying. Several names flashed through Shui Mingyue’s mind. After training at the literature academy so long, it was normal for Wen Ying to stay in touch with other students.

The female lead listened intently because Wen Ying’s description gave her strong identification.

Unlike Luo Hao, who was scouted by the directing team at school, the female lead was discovered by a talent scout in high school and recommended for commercials.

In the entertainment industry, merely fresh looks are considered standout in real life. The female lead had been praised as pretty by relatives and friends since childhood. As a young girl with vanity, she thought one commercial would make her soar… Reality proved she was too naive.

The commercial aired with good response.

Then nothing followed.

No one stays famous long from a single commercial. Initial attention needs follow-up works to sustain.

The female lead was awakened by reality. She later shot second and third commercials, then sporadic jobs. Only in the third year did she get a chance for a supporting role in a drama. In this process, some tried to deceive her for sex, some wanted her to sign exploitative contracts, others tried to bind her emotionally so she would willingly slave for them.

Wen Ying’s phrase “overcoming obstacles in a posture not elegant or graceful” struck the female lead hard, because that was exactly her experience. She suffered many losses before understanding the industry’s rules. Finally, she got the chance to play the female lead in the adaptation of Shui Mingyue’s work.

Wen Ying paused midway, not continuing. The female lead grew anxious. “Teacher Xiaoyu, what happens next?”

Wen Ying glanced at her. “What happens next, my writer friend has not decided yet. Anyway, the plot is quite abusive. The girl finally fights for the chance to play the ‘female lead’, yet does not live to see the drama air. After airing, the girl has already retired and married. The drama’s popularity and the role’s fame have nothing to do with her anymore. My friend has settled on this ending. The process is tricky. Why would the girl retire when her future is bright? My friend fears setting the abusive point too lightly to convince readers, yet also fears abusing too harshly and getting scolded. After all, in the earlier setup, this girl has no major flaws beyond wanting to rise in the entertainment industry. My friend cannot bear to abuse her too severely.”

Is this not harsh enough?

The female lead put herself in the role and suddenly felt like crying.

She too had waited so long for an opportunity.

Though Shui Mingyue’s adapted drama had modest investment, after reading the script and original, the female lead felt it would be a hit.

For truly big-budget dramas, roles would not come to someone of her small status.

Wen Ying’s plot not only made the female lead want to cry but also left an uncomfortable lump in her heart. Identifying with it felt distressing and inauspicious.

The female lead looked resentfully at Wen Ying. “Teacher Xiaoyu, if we had no grudge, I would suspect you were insinuating about me.”
